Dogs have been known for their positive impact on mental health for centuries. Whether you’re feeling stressed, sad, or just need a companion, having a dog can be incredibly beneficial for your mental well-being. Here are ten reasons why having a dog can be good for your mental health:


  1. Stress Reduction: Dogs have been shown to help reduce stress levels in their owners. Spending time with your dog can help you forget about your worries and focus on the present moment. Just petting your dog or taking them for a walk can help lower your blood pressure and decrease stress hormones in your body.
  2. Increases Happiness: Owning a dog has been linked to increased levels of happiness and life satisfaction. When you’re around your dog, you can’t help but smile and laugh, and this positive energy can have a lasting effect on your mood.
  3. Boosts Confidence: Dogs can be great confidence boosters, especially for people who feel anxious in social situations. Taking your dog for a walk or to a dog park can provide an opportunity to meet new people and have meaningful conversations, which can help build confidence.
  4. Decreases Loneliness: Dogs can provide comfort and companionship when you’re feeling lonely. Whether you’re living alone or just need a companion, a dog can provide unconditional love and be a constant source of comfort.
  5. Increases Physical Activity: Owning a dog can help increase physical activity levels, which can have positive effects on mental health. Taking your dog for a walk or playing with them in the park can be a fun and enjoyable way to get moving and improve your physical and mental well-being.
  6. Provides a Sense of Purpose: Taking care of a dog can give you a sense of purpose and meaning. Knowing that your dog depends on you for their basic needs can help you feel needed and appreciated.
  7. Decreases Depression Symptoms: Studies have shown that dogs can help reduce symptoms of depression and anxiety. The simple act of spending time with your dog and focusing on their needs can help distract you from negative thoughts and improve your overall mood.
  8. Promotes Social Interaction: Owning a dog can provide opportunities for social interaction, especially if you take them to a dog park or enroll them in dog-related activities. Interacting with other dog owners can help improve your social skills and provide opportunities for new friendships.
  9. Increases Self-Esteem: Taking care of a dog can help increase self-esteem and confidence. Knowing that you’re responsible for the well-being of another living being can help you feel more confident and capable.
  10. Enhances Mental Stimulation: Dogs require mental stimulation and training, which can help keep your mind sharp and active. Whether you’re teaching your dog new tricks or just playing with them, you’ll be challenged mentally and can enjoy the sense of accomplishment that comes with training a dog.

In conclusion, the benefits of having a dog for mental health are numerous. From reducing stress and increasing happiness, to providing a sense of purpose and enhancing mental stimulation, owning a dog can have a positive impact on your mental well-being. Whether you’re looking for a companion or just need to improve your mood, a dog can be an excellent addition to your life.

Popular Posts

dogs are good for kids

You Won’t Believe These 15 Reasons Why Having A Dog Is Good For Your Mental Health

dog bath and grooming supplies towels

Keep Your Buddy Nice and Tidy: Dog Grooming Tips and Tools


I Love My Dog So Much is an American-Based Online Magazine Focused On Dogs, Including Entertainment, Wellness, Educational Resources For Pet Owners, Advocacy, And Animal Rescue.
